Zone de test pour le développement du forum.
-
igotoy
- Messages :275
- Enregistré le :jeu. 18 févr. 2010 17:11
- Club :38Gr
- Niveau :5k
- Pseudo KGS/IGS :igotoy
- Localisation :Grenoble
-
Contact :
Re: Tests lecteurs SGF
Message
par igotoy » lun. 23 janv. 2012 20:18
fanfan a écrit :A propos des fonctions "Revenir à l'embranchement précédent" (ou "aller à l'embranchement suivant"), devant la pression populaire
, j'ai rajouté ça à la future version de gos :
http://www.jeudego.org/gos/_gos5/_sampl ... /forum.php
J'ai aussi ajouter un bouton "Sgf" dans l'exemple du forum afin qu'un utilisateur puisse éventuellement enregistrer le sgf via un copier-coller dans un éditeur de texte.
Je ne pense pas qu'il soit utile d'avoir des fonctions d'édition sophistiqué incluses dans le lecteur pour l'usage qui en est fait dans le forum (la possibilité d'essayer des variantes me semble suffisante en l'état). Mais si vous pensez le contraire, n'hésitez pas à m'en faire part.
Note : je n'ai pas testé avec ie 6 ou 7. Ça marche lentement (mais surement) avec ie 8. Avec les autres navigateurs, il ne devrait pas y avoir de problème.
Testé sous Chrome (windows) et ça marche fort bien. Les variations et éditions sont bien enregistrées dans le fichier généré. Par contre je pense que ça serait mieux si on téléchargeait directement le fichier plutôt que de devoir copier/coller. En php, le bouton de téléchargement lancerait un truc dans le genre :
Code : Tout sélectionner
$sgf = "Contenu du fichier SGF...";
header("Content-disposition: attachment; filename=\"partie.sgf\"" );
header("Content-Type: x-go-sgf" ); ou header("Content-Type: application/octet-stream" );
header("Content-Transfer-Encoding: text/plain" );
header("Content-Length: ".strlen($sgf));
header("Pragma: no-cache" );
header("Cache-Control: no-store, no-cache, must-revalidate, post-check=0, pre-check=0" );
header("Expires: 0" );
echo $sgf;
Dans la vie j'ai deux passions : mon pays et Bruce Lee !
-
gludion
- Messages :17
- Enregistré le :jeu. 4 mars 2010 15:53
- Club :Aligre
- Niveau :3d
- Pseudo KGS/IGS :hariko
Message
par gludion » lun. 23 janv. 2012 20:23
Et à ce propos, je n'ai pas trouvé comment ajouter les "AB" et "AW" du sgf. C'est moi ou c'est "by design" ?
C'est "by design" paske à la base c'est plutot pour commenter une partie existante donc pas mal de trucs ne sont pas éditables
A part ça, ta version 5.27 a l'air super!!
-
fanfan
- Messages :123
- Enregistré le :jeu. 18 févr. 2010 19:15
- Club :Yosakura Nantes
- Niveau :3d
- Pseudo KGS/IGS :fanfan
-
Contact :
Message
par fanfan » lun. 23 janv. 2012 20:31
Gos sait déjà faire ça (lancer un téléchargement via un php) et c'est d'ailleurs ce que fait
http://jeudego.org/edit/, mais comme je le disais plus haut, ça pose pas mal de problème en particulier parce que cette fonction de téléchargement est désactivée sur pas mal de machines (dont la plupart sont aussi celles qui ne supportent pas flash). Mais bon, si tu préfères un téléchargement, je le mets : j'ai juste une ligne dans le fichier de configuration de gos pour le forum à modifier
.
C'est tout ce qui restait comme pseudo?
-
fanfan
- Messages :123
- Enregistré le :jeu. 18 févr. 2010 19:15
- Club :Yosakura Nantes
- Niveau :3d
- Pseudo KGS/IGS :fanfan
-
Contact :
Message
par fanfan » lun. 23 janv. 2012 20:53
C'est tout ce qui restait comme pseudo?
-
fanfan
- Messages :123
- Enregistré le :jeu. 18 févr. 2010 19:15
- Club :Yosakura Nantes
- Niveau :3d
- Pseudo KGS/IGS :fanfan
-
Contact :
Message
par fanfan » lun. 23 janv. 2012 21:12
gludion a écrit :Et à ce propos, je n'ai pas trouvé comment ajouter les "AB" et "AW" du sgf. C'est moi ou c'est "by design" ?
C'est "by design" paske à la base c'est plutot pour commenter une partie existante donc pas mal de trucs ne sont pas éditables
Il est vrai que les propriétés AB et AW servent essentiellement pour la pose des pierres de handicap et les énoncés de problème. Donc en effet, pouvoir les modifier aurait ici peu d'intérêt (même si dans quelques rares on pourrait être amené dans un commentaire à en avoir l'usage) !
gludion a écrit :A part ça, ta version 5.27 a l'air super!!
Merci beaucoup !
C'est tout ce qui restait comme pseudo?